  • Abstract
    Variogram as an important mathematical model of Kriging can effectively describe the features of the variants in some districts of ore deposit. This paper presents a isoline drawing method which uses genetic algorithm (GA) to estimate the Kriging variogram parameters. This method called GA-based Kriging was compared to ordinary Kriging. The isolines interpolated by GA-based Kriging are of higher precision and smaller error. GA-based Kriging provides a good tool for engineering application.
